You can contact local community centers or organizations that offer classes in British Sign Language (BSL) in Skegness, Lincolnshire. You may also consider reaching out to schools for the deaf or hearing-impaired or searching online for BSL courses in the area. Engaging with the deaf community can also be a great way to learn and practice BSL.

Do you think deaf kids with Cochlear Implant should learn sign language as well as vocal language?

Yes, it is beneficial for deaf children with cochlear implants to learn sign language in addition to spoken language. Sign language can provide them with an additional mode of communication that may be more accessible and natural for some individuals. Learning both sign language and spoken language can enhance their communication skills and overall development.


How long does it take to learn sign language?

The time to learn sign language can vary depending on factors such as the individual's dedication, the frequency of practice, and prior experience with languages. It can take a few months to a few years to become proficient in sign language. Regular practice and immersion in the language can speed up the learning process.
